HP Officejet 5200 Printer Wireless Setup

To perform the HP Officejet 5200 wireless setup, you are required to follow the steps mentioned below:

First of all, turn on your HP wireless printer. You can use the touchscreen to connect your printer to a wireless network.

On the touchscreen, you need to press the right arrow key and then press setup.

Choose Network from the setup menu.

Select Wireless Setup Wizard from the Network menu; it will search for the wireless routers in the range.

Choose your Network (SSID) from the list.

Enter the WEP/WPA Passphrase for the network and then press Done.

Press OK to confirm the settings.

Press OK to print Wireless report or Skip.

HP Officejet 5200 Wireless Setup for Windows

Go through the steps given below to connect the HP Officejet 5200 printer to a Wireless network on Windows:

Before you begin the procedure for wireless setup, you have to know all the necessary details, such as network name and password.

Make sure to connect your computer to a strong network connection.

 Make sure to place the router and printer close to each other.

Tap the Wireless option from on the printer’s control panel and then open the Wireless setup wizard.

Choose your network from the list of network names available there.

Follow the instructions asked from the printer home screen.

Install the software using CD, and once the download is finished, run the downloaded printer software.

Lastly, type the desired connection and complete the installation process.

Your HP Officejet 5200 printer has been connected wirelessly on Windows OS.
